1,父组件向子组件传值2.子组件向父组件传值3.没有嵌套关系的组件传值 // 父组件 var MyContainer = React.createClass({getInitialState: function () {return { checked: true };},render: function() {return ( <ToggleButton text="Toggle
原创
2022-07-13 11:31:24
158阅读
谈及React时,就会想到一个很重要的思想,就是组件化思想。它将可以重用的部分进行组件化开发,形成一个个相对独立的组件,那么组件化后,你也会提出些疑问,组件与组件之间,将怎样进行信息的传递呢?下面来介绍下组件之间传递信息的方法。 组件之间传递信息方式,总体可分为以下5种: 1.(父组件)向(子组件)
转载
2018-02-09 17:53:00
316阅读
2评论
–简介:–React中的组件: 解决html标签构建应用的不足–使用组件的好处: 把公共的功能单独抽离成一个文件作为一个组件,哪里使用哪里引入.–父子组件: 组件的相互调用中,我们把调用者成为父组件,被调用者成为子组件–父子组件传值(react 父子组件通信) :父组件给子组件传值–1. 在调用子组件的时候定义个属性,–2 子组件里面this.props.msg说明: 父组件不...
原创
2021-08-30 14:03:16
300阅读
1.通过 AsyncStorage 将值保存在本地(最低端的方法) 2.定义成员属性 通过 props 传值(父组件向子组件传值) CommunalCell.js 定义成员属性 接收外部传值 引用 传值 3.通过回调方法传值 (子组件向父组件传值) 子组件 父组件 .
转载
2017-09-06 10:09:00
158阅读
2评论
路径传参:可以用<Route path='/newsdeta/:id' component={Newsdeta}></Route>在组件里面就可以用:this.props.match.params.idimport React, { Component } from 'react';class newsdeta extends Component { render() { const id = this.props conso
原创
2021-09-03 14:51:19
446阅读
路径传参:可以用<Route path='/newsdeta/:id' component={Newsdeta}></Route>在组件里面就可以用:this.props.match.params.idimport React, { Component }
原创
2022-01-11 14:52:24
192阅读
主要组件 import React from 'react' import {Link, Route} from 'react-router-dom' import Detial from './Detial' class Message extends React.Component{ state ...
转载
2021-08-02 22:53:00
377阅读
2评论
/* react路由的配置: 1、找到官方文档 https://reacttraining.com/react-router/web/example/basic 2、安装 cnpm install react-router-dom --save 3、找到项目的根组件引入react-router-do
转载
2021-08-13 08:44:51
249阅读
react 组件之间传值的方案有很多,下面是我个人经验的总结props 来传递值传值方式:通过props 获取值通过props 提供的func去修改值优点:不需要任何第三方的组件,纯react,非常纯哦缺点:代码调试有些麻烦,但是可以react 插件辅助查看到当前react 对象的props注意事项:一般在表单页面中用到组件时候会用到props 传递值,需要注意下,最好页面的状态控制都在该页面的顶
转载
2024-04-11 12:23:06
57阅读
一.props.params官方例子使用React router定义路由时,我们可以给<Route>指定一个path,然后指定通配符可以携带参数到指定的path:首先定义路由到UserPage页面: import { Router,Route,hashHistory} from 'react-rou ...
转载
2021-07-23 15:19:00
3085阅读
2评论
路由规则:<Route path="/detail/:id" component={HouseDetail}></Route>import { BrowserRouter as Router, R
原创
2022-11-18 00:16:28
189阅读
一、动态路由 我们通过配置基本路由,可以实现页面间的切换,但是如果在一个页面中有一列表标题,我们点击各个标题,就能进入到此标题所表示的内容页面中,这该如何实现呢,下面就要用到我们的动态路由了,实际效果如下图所示: 首先,我们已经在App根组件中已经配置了主页、新闻、产品三个组件的路由,如下: 接下来我们要在News组件中定义一组数据,然后将其渲染到...
原创
2021-08-26 15:06:23
2587阅读
一、动态路由 我们通过配置基本路由,可以实现页面间的切换,
原创
2022-02-21 16:03:12
815阅读
今天,我们要讨论的是react router中Link传值的三种表现形式。分别为通过通配符传参、query传参和state传参。 ps:进入正题前,先说明一下,以下的所有内容都是在react-router V4的版本下。 1.params Route定义方式: Link组件: HTML方式 JS方式
转载
2018-07-04 19:11:00
119阅读
2评论
4.React路由传参 class Message extends Component { state = { messageArr: [ {id: '01', title: '消息1'}, {id: '02', title: '消息2'}, {id: '03', title: '消息3'}, ] ...
转载
2021-09-03 16:41:00
140阅读
今天,我们要讨论的是react router中Link传值的三种表现形式。分别为通过通配符传参、query传参和state传参。 ps:进入正题前,先说明一下,以下的所有内容都是在react-router V4的版本下。 1.通配符传参 Route定义方式: <Route path='/path/:
转载
2020-03-31 10:19:00
218阅读
2评论
–动态路由实现页面跳转//首先在根组件引入router配置return( <Router> <div> <header className="title"> <Link to='/'>首页</> <Link to='/news'>新闻&...
原创
2021-08-30 14:12:15
205阅读
在winform中 窗体之间的传值
点击form1中的按钮,跳转到form2中,并显示form1中的某个数据
string uid="某个控件的值";
private void butto1_Click(object sender,EventArgs e)
{
&
原创
2010-07-14 19:31:11
329阅读
1评论
Activity之间的传值: 方法1: 1给2传值Activity1: final Intent intent = new Inten
原创
2023-04-18 08:46:41
76阅读
private String url;@Overridepublic void onCreate(Bundle savedInstanceState) {super.onCreate(savedInstanceState);savedInstanceState = getArguments();if (savedInstanceState != null) {url = s...
原创
2021-08-15 12:16:29
395阅读